  2. The commentry underneath is a bit misleading. It's been reported countless times but Nuhi stands on his position. Nevertheless, it says "SFC: Enabled (Default) /Disabled" so clearly, you leave it enabled (which you did) or you change it to disabled. It's not about "enabling the disabling" like lots of people seem to understand. Cheers.

  6. SP3 is cumulative. You need SP1 to install SP3 on a running XP but not to slipstream it to a cd. At least that's what I read here several times. This should work. Please attach your presets and what's written on your original disc.
  7. Either your serial is not working with the disc you start with or you integrate SP2 with nLite and your serial is blacklisted by SP2. From all the similar posts we've had, it's always been one of those two answers.
